    Delta Star provides power solutions for utilities across North America. This includes the manufacturing of medium-power transformers, mobile transformers, mobile electrical substations, trailers, and unitized substations.

    We offer power transformers for utility applications including power and distribution, transmission voltages, system ties, and automatic voltage regulations, as well as industrial applications.

    Delta Star also provides comprehensive engineering, testing, maintenance services, and parts for any transformer manufacturer through our Field Service business unit, ensuring our customer's transformers and mobiles maintain peak performance.


    PURPOSE
    Conduct daily internal product/process audits, maintain product quality records, and provide quality control support throughout operations. Promote the Quality Management System, continuous improvement, teamwork, customer satisfaction, and individual job excellence. Report non-conformances, control non-conforming material, and participate in the identification of corrective actions.

    M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ES
    Perform detailed dimensional inspection of component parts.
    Resolve customer issues.
    Maintain filing of supplier documentation.
    Verify that equipment is manufactured and tested to specified requirements.
    Occasionally perform inspection and witness activities at customer or supplier sites.
    Assist the QA leaders as needed.
